Firing incident: Four killed in South Waziristan

Security forces have cordoned off area after the incident

PESHAWAR: At least four workers were killed when unidentified men opened fire at them in the Ladha tehsil of South Waziristan.

According to Express News, the incident took place in the wee hours of Saturday after which the attackers fled the crime scene.

The political administration in the area has sent out a team to pick the bodies and arrange the funeral.

The investigation is being carried out to determine the reason behind the firing. The security forces have also cordoned off the area.

Grenade attack kills four, injures 32 in North Waziristan

On Friday, four people were killed and 32 others injured when a hand grenade was hurled at a wedding ceremony in Dandai Saidgai village in North Waziristan, a senior political administration official told The Express Tribune.

The marriage ceremony came under attack when unidentified militants threw a hand grenade into the house of Shandi Gul in Dandai. At least five critically injured victims have been moved to Peshawar for medical assistance while others were moved to the Agency Hospital in Miranshah. The official said that the injured included at least seven children and many wounded were critical.

Earlier this month, a security official was martyred and three others injured when a bomb disposal unit of Pakistan Army was targeted by an Improvised Explosive Device (IED) in North Waziristan.
